What time is on the clock in Back to the Future?

A key moment in the town’s fictional history takes place on Saturday, November 12, 1955, at 10:04 p.m. PST, when lightning strikes the courthouse’s clock tower, freezing the clock at 10:04.

What time does Marty travel to in the past?

After Doc is shot by Libyan terrorists, Marty goes through time at 1:35 am and travels instantly to Saturday, November 5, 1955 at 6:15 am.

Why is November 5 1955 Back to the Future?

Marty McFly used the DeLorean time machine to escape Libyan terrorists and accidentally traveled back in time to the very day Dr. Emmett L. Brown conceived of the possibility of time travel: November 5, 1955.

Where is the Back to the Future clock located?

Sadly, none of us can visit the fine folks of Hill Valley, but we can go the spot of the clock tower which is located on the back lot of Universal Studios in Hollywood, California. Back to the Future made ‘Courthouse Square’ a star, as much as it did Michael J.

When was the clock tower built in Back to the Future?

It was first constructed in 1885. On September 3, 1885, it almost experienced its first hanging by Buford Tannen before Dr. Emmett Brown intervened. A ceremony held during the September 5th Hill Valley Festival started the clock at 8:00 pm.

Where was the clock scene filmed in Back to the Future?

Some of the most iconic scenes of BTTF were filmed in the Universal Studios Hollywood lot. You can visit the famous clock tower and square from the first two movies on the Backlot Tour. The building and square have been repurposed for other films, but it’s still very obvious if you’ve seen the movie more than once.
